Some bits and pieces of The 4-Hour Body by Timothy Ferriss
‘’People will think that because genes play a role in something, they determine everything. We see, again and again, people saying, “It’s all genetic. I can’t do anything about it.” That’s nonsense. To say that something has a genetic component does not make it unchangeable.’’

“Cellulite is fat. Nothing special, neither a disease nor a unique female problem without solutions. It can be removed.’’
‘’Marketers have conditioned women to believe that they need specific programs and diets “for women.” This is an example of capitalism at its worst: creating false need and confusion.’’

‘’But what is this all-important “Harajuku Moment”? It’s an epiphany that turns a nice-to-have into a must-have. There is no point in getting started until it happens.’’

‘’Tracking anything is better than tracking nothing.’’

‘’Simple: logic fails. If you were to summarize the last 100 years of behavioral psychology in two words, that would be the takeaway.’’

‘’Think of them as insurance against the weaknesses of human nature—your weaknesses, my weaknesses, our weaknesses: 1. Make it conscious. 2. Make it a game. 3. Make it competitive. 4. Make it small and temporary.’’

‘’If you are hungry, you’re not eating enough protein and legumes at each meal.’’

‘’If you could only do one movement for the rest of your life, do the kettlebell swing.’’

‘’The crucial principle is to lift heavy but not hard.’’

“Based on all of the literature I’ve reviewed, the phytoestrogens in soy are dangerous for adults and, to a greater extent, children, even when used in moderation. Studies have demonstrated that just 30 grams of soy per day (about two tablespoons) for 90 days can disrupt thyroid function, and that’s in Japanese subjects. The Swiss Federal Health Service equated 100 milligrams of isoflavones (phytoestrogens) to a single birth control pill in terms of estrogenic impact. How many birth control pills are you inadvertently eating each day? FOOD TOTAL ISOFLAVONES(IN 100 G SERVING) Instant soy beverage 109.51 mg Raw soybeans (Japanese) 118.51 mg (in less than half a cup) Fried tofu 48.35 mg (7–8 small pieces) Tempeh 43.52 mg (in less than two-thirds of a cup) Common infant soy formula.’’

“So, how can you do it without soy? Answer: Either extensive whole foods, which requires prep time, or powdered protein, which requires budget. The whole-food options will be covered in the case studies, though you’ll see some soy products creep in. For supplementation, the most consistently recommended protein powders among vegan athletes are: Sun Warrior Chocolate Brown Rice Protein (rice protein) Pure Advantage Pea Protein Isolate (pea protein) Nitro Fusion Plant Fusion (rice, pea, and artichoke protein) I have also confirmed each of these as non-vomit-inducing when blended with 1–2 tablespoons of almond butter and either ice water, almond milk, or coconut milk.”
